Choosing the Right Time for Your Surprise
Timing plays a primary role in establishing the mood of your excursion. The river changes its character entirely depending on the position of the sun, casting different shadows and reflections across the stone facades framing the water.
Morning Serenity on the Water
Booking a morning departure offers a tranquil, refreshing start to the day. The city awakens slowly, and the river remains relatively quiet before the main rush of commercial traffic begins to populate the water. The morning light provides a crisp, clear illumination of magnificent monuments like the Louvre and the distinctive towers of Notre-Dame. Presenting this surprise early in the day sets a positive, relaxed tone for whatever other activities you have planned. It offers a moment of deep calm before you begin exploring the museums or meandering through the various neighborhoods on foot.
The Golden Hour and Parisian Sunsets
Late afternoon, leading gently into the golden hour, bathes the city in a warm, amber glow. The intricate stone bridges reflect this light beautifully, making it an ideal time for capturing elegant portraits together. As the sun begins to set, the sky often transitions through shades of pale pink, deep orange, and soft violet. Orchestrating a reveal during this specific window ensures your partner experiences the breathtaking transition between daytime clarity and evening elegance. The shifting light continuously alters the appearance of the buildings, creating a highly dynamic visual experience.
Evening Cruises Beneath the City Lights
Nightfall brings an entirely different kind of charm to the waterway. The monuments are illuminated from below by carefully placed spotlights, casting dramatic reflections on the dark, rippling water. The Eiffel Tower’s sparkling light show becomes a focal point of the skyline, glowing brightly against the night sky. An evening booking provides a sophisticated, refined atmosphere, serving as an excellent prelude to a late dinner in one of the city’s celebrated restaurants. The cool evening air and the warm glow of the streetlamps create a deeply atmospheric journey.

Practical Tips for a Flawless Booking
Securing the right arrangement requires some dedicated attention to detail prior to your arrival. Administrative foresight guarantees the actual day of the surprise unfolds without logistical complications.
Reserving Your Date in Advance
Premium private options experience high demand, particularly during the busy travel seasons of spring and early autumn. To secure your preferred time slot—especially if you aim for the highly sought-after sunset hours—booking well ahead of your travel dates is strongly recommended. Early reservation gives you deep peace of mind and allows you to build the rest of your daily itinerary around this central event. Many guests later describe this exact ninety-minute window as the absolute highlight of their trip to Paris, making it a critical priority during the early planning phase.
Keeping the Secret Safe
Managing digital footprints is crucial when planning a surprise for someone you live or travel with. Ensure confirmation emails are sent directly to an address your partner does not regularly access. If you share calendar applications on your mobile devices, remember to mark the time slot simply as a general “Sightseeing Tour” or “Afternoon Activity” rather than listing the specific company name. By keeping the logistical details completely obscured, you preserve the magical element of surprise right up until the memorable moment you approach the waiting vessel on the docks.
